Aerospace Welding

Aerospace parts made from Invar 36, Inconel, or titanium need absolute precision. TIP TIG keeps heat input low. Distortion stays within the tightest tolerances. Wire agitation produces porosity-free, X-ray quality welds under 100% Argon. Post-weld cleanup needs only a wire brush.

Proven in the Field

SpaceX Starship — From 5 bar to 8.5 bar in 40 Days

In November 2019, a Starship tank welded with Flux Core exploded at just 5 bar during pressure testing. SpaceX switched to TIP TIG. Within 40 days, the new tanks reached 8.5 bar — the target for crewed flights. Every Starship and Super Heavy tank is now welded with TIP TIG. The switch also brought 20% mass reduction through more precise joints.
